GENERAL SANTOS CITY, Feb 1 Asia Pulse - After two years of waiting, local government units (LGUs) in the country will finally get an increase this year in their Internal Revenue Allotments (IRA) from the national government.

South Cotabato Governor Daisy Avance-Fuentes bared this development today saying that the Senate, which is now discussing the national budget, has made a commitment to the Union of Local Authorities of the Philippines (ULAP) "not to touch" the proposed P10 billion (US$181.8 million) intended for the increase in the IRA shares of LGUs for this year.
